EXTRAORDINARY SHOW – FOLKLORE TREASURY

The Crişana Professional Artistic Ensemble of the Regina Maria Theater, together with the Bihor County Council, with the support of the Oradea City Hall, presents the ensemble's most important premiere of 2015: the Extraordinary Folklore Treasure Concert, an event organized on the occasion of the Crişana Orchestra's 65th anniversary.

The extraordinary concert Tezaur Folcloric will take place on April 2, 2015, at 6:00 PM, in the Great Hall of the Regina Maria Theater.

The concert will feature the most beautiful voices of Romanian folk music: Sava Negrean Brudaşcu, Petrică Mîţu Stoian, Veta Biriş, Cristian Pomohaci, Mariana Deac, Liliana Laichici, Leontin Ciucur, Cornel Borza, Elvira Lerinţiu, Domniţa Sabaduş Pop, Maria Sidea, Maria Haiduc, Florica Zaha, Radu Potoran, Ionel Ban, Simona Costin, Otilia Haragoş Seghedi, Felicia Costin, Cornelia Covaciu, Luminiţa Tomuţa, Voichiţa Mihoc, Alexandru Brădăţan, Pamfil Roată, George Finiş, Ovidiu Homorodean, Cristian Fodor, Ovidiu Olari, Stefan Deaconiţa, Costantin Bahrin, Olguţa Berbec, Roberta Crintea, Florentina and Petre Giurgi, Ana Maria Gal, Nicoleta Rab, Florina Puşcău, Violeta Gherman, Dana Ionela Jurjuţ, Vladuţa Lupău, Codruţa Rodean, Andreea Haisan, Stângaciu and Stângaciu Junior, Petrică Popa, Dumbrava Ensemble from Bălnaca.

Conductor: Adrian Miescu

Set designer: Aurelia Ticulescu

Producer and presenter: Gheorghiţa Nicolae

Artistic director: Leontin Ciucur

Director General Manager: Daniel Vulcu

Tickets can be purchased from the theater agency, open Monday through Friday between 10:00 and 19:00 and Saturday and Sunday between 10:00 and 13:00. They can also be purchased online at www.biletmaster.roThe prices are as follows:

30 lei – central lodges

25 lei – side boxes and hall

20 lei – first row in the balcony

15 lei – the rest of the balcony rows

An enemy of the people
| Queen Marie Theatre

The "Iosif Vulcan" troupe of the Regina Maria Theater in Oradea presents on Sunday, November 24, 2024, from 7:00 PM, at the Great Hall, the premiere of the show "An Enemy of the People", adaptation by Thomas Ostermeier and Florian Borchmeyer after Henrik Ibsen, directed by Radu Iacoban.

The cast consists of: Alina Leonte (Katharina Stockmann), Richard Balint (Peter Stockmann), Răzvan Vicoveanu (Thomas Stockmann), Gabriela Codrea (Nina Aslaksen), Elvira Rîmbu (Marta Kill), Alin Stanciu (Hovstad) and Tudor Manea (Billing).
